Parliament dissolved ahead of election

The Scottish Parliament is now dissolved ahead of the election on Thursday 7 May 2026.

During dissolution, there are no MSPs and no parliamentary business can take place.

Public Audit Committee

Wednesday 21 May 2025 9:30 AM

LIVE

Details

1. Decision on taking business in private: The Committee will decide whether to take agenda items 3, 4 and 5 in private. 2. Scottish Government's approach to financial interventions: Strategic Commercial Assets Division: The Committee will take evidence from— Gregor Irwin, Director-General Economy, Colin Cook, Director of Economic Development, and Dermot Rhatigan, Deputy Director, Strategic Commercial Assets Division, Scottish Government. 3. Scottish Government's approach to financial interventions: Strategic Commercial Assets Division: The Committee will consider the evidence heard at agenda item 2 and take further evidence from— Stephen Boyle, Auditor General for Scotland; Carole Grant, Audit Director, and Dharshi Santhakumaran, Senior Manager, Audit Scotland. 4. Scottish Government's approach to financial interventions: Strategic Commercial Assets Division: The Committee will consider the evidence it heard at agenda items 2 and 3 and agree any further action it wishes to take. 5. Annual report: The Committee will consider a draft annual report for the parliamentary year from 13 May 2024 to 12 May 2025.
